This guide will walk you through the process step by step, so you can ensure your concerns are addressed professionally and efficiently. ![6](https://hackmd.io/_uploads/Sy4Yieu-Wx.png) ## Understanding Princess complaint procedures Princess Cruises takes guest feedback seriously and has a structured process to manage complaints. The process typically involves: 1. **Immediate onboard communication** – Address issues directly during your cruise. 2. **Post-cruise feedback** – Submit concerns after your voyage via email or online forms. 3. **Escalation** – If the issue is unresolved, there are ways to escalate through guest relations or higher management. Knowing how to navigate these steps increases your chances of a fair outcome. --- ## Filing a complaint during your cruise If your complaint arises while onboard, addressing it immediately can be beneficial: ### 1. Contact Guest Services * Every Princess ship has a **Guest Services desk** available 24/7. * Staff are trained to resolve issues quickly, whether they relate to your cabin, dining, excursions, or onboard services. * Politely explain your issue, providing as much detail as possible. ### 2. Use the Princess Medallion app * Many Princess ships have integrated services through the **Medallion app**. * Guests can send messages to Guest Services or crew directly from their cabin or anywhere on the ship. * This method creates a **written record** of your complaint, which is useful if you need to escalate later. ### 3. Request follow-up * Ask the staff to confirm the next steps or provide a timeline for resolution. * Request a reference number or note the names of employees who assisted you. Immediate onboard action is often the fastest way to resolve complaints because the crew can address issues in real time. --- ## Filing a complaint after your cruise If the issue was not resolved onboard or you only noticed a problem after returning home, Princess provides multiple avenues to submit complaints: ### 1. Online guest relations form * Visit the official Princess Cruises website and navigate to **Guest Relations** or **Contact Us**. * Fill out the **guest relations form** with the requested details: * Full name and contact information * Ship name and sailing dates * Cabin or booking number * Description of the issue * Supporting documents or photos if applicable ### 2. Email * Some regions provide a direct **customer service Princess email**. * Your message should be structured clearly, with a concise subject line such as: “Cruise Complaint – [Booking Number] – [Ship Name]” ### 3. Postal mail (optional) * For formal complaints requiring detailed documentation, you can send a **written letter** to Princess Cruises’ corporate office. * Include all relevant information, copies of receipts, and any correspondence with onboard staff. Using written methods post-cruise ensures that your complaint is documented and routed to the appropriate department for review. --- ## What to include in your Princess complaint form To increase the likelihood of a prompt and fair response, your complaint should be **clear, detailed, and organized**. Include the following: 1. **Guest details** – Full name, address, phone number, email, and booking number. 2. **Cruise details** – Ship name, sailing date, cabin number, and any other identifying information. 3. **Description of the issue** – Provide a chronological account, including dates, times, and locations. 4. **Actions taken** – Mention if you spoke to Guest Services or crew and the responses received. 5. **Supporting documentation** – Receipts, photos, emails, or messages that validate your complaint. 6. **Desired resolution** – Clearly state what you are seeking: compensation, apology, correction, or clarification. A well-structured complaint helps Princess staff assess the situation quickly and reduces delays caused by follow-up requests for more information. --- ## Sample letter for Princess cruise complaint Here’s a sample structure for a **formal complaint letter**: --- **Subject:** Complaint – Booking #123456 – Sapphire Princess **Dear Guest Relations,** I recently sailed on the **Sapphire Princess** from [Departure Port] to [Destination] from [Date] to [Date]. I am writing to formally address an issue encountered during my voyage. [Provide a detailed description of the complaint, including dates, locations, and staff interactions.] I previously brought this matter to **Guest Services** onboard, but the issue remains unresolved. Attached are supporting documents, including [receipts/photos]. I am requesting [state desired resolution]. Thank you for your attention to this matter. I look forward to your response. Persistence and organization are key; keeping records of all correspondence ensures your case is clearly documented. --- ## Tips for a successful Princess complaint * **Be polite and professional** – Aggressive or hostile messages are less likely to get favorable outcomes. * **Provide clear evidence** – Photos, receipts, and timestamps strengthen your case. * **Include all relevant details** – The more precise your complaint, the easier it is for staff to investigate. * **Follow timelines** – File complaints promptly, ideally within a few weeks after the cruise. * **Document all communication** – Keep copies of emails, forms, and letters for reference. Following these tips helps **customer service Princess** teams resolve complaints efficiently and fairly. --- ## Common types of complaints handled by Princess Passengers often submit complaints for issues like: * Cabin cleanliness or maintenance problems * Food quality or service delays in dining venues * Excursion cancellations or itinerary changes * Onboard staff interactions * Billing or charge disputes * Lost or damaged personal items Princess Cruises has policies and procedures to review and address all these concerns, whether submitted during the voyage or afterward. --- ## FAQs **1.
